Add ImportSuccessModal tests, enhance AuthContext for token management, and improve useImport hook
- Implement tests for ImportSuccessModal to verify rendering and functionality. - Update AuthContext to store authentication token in localStorage and manage token state. - Modify useImport hook to capture and expose commit results, preventing unnecessary refetches. - Enhance useCertificates hook to support optional refetch intervals. - Update Dashboard to conditionally poll certificates based on pending status. - Integrate ImportSuccessModal into ImportCaddy for user feedback on import completion. - Adjust Login component to utilize returned token for authentication. - Refactor CrowdSecConfig tests for improved readability and reliability. - Add debug_db.py script for inspecting the SQLite database. - Update integration and test scripts for better configuration and error handling. - Introduce Trivy scan script for vulnerability assessment of Docker images.
